The Way of St James is the pilgrimage route to the Cathedral of Santiago de Compostela in Galicia in northwestern Spain, where the remains of the apostle James are believed to be buried. The network of footpaths and tracks used by the pilgrims over the centuries converge on Santiago and this cycling holiday follows both these tracks and local country lanes and roads. On this holiday you will cycle through a unique historical landscape, which is very different to that of traditional Spain, with greener, gentler scenery and a mild climate suitable for cycling almost all year round.

Day 1 Arrive Oviedo.

Day 2 Oviedo to Leon.
An optional vehicle transfer can be taken into the Cantabrian Hills which misses out the first 11 miles of climbing up into the hills. From here, the route takes you through a beautiful landscape of hills and emerald green valleys leading to the flatter countryside surrounding the Castilian town of Leon. ~ 25 or 36 miles depending on transfer

Day 3 Leon to Astorga.
Deserted villages of clay buildings dot the countryside today as you ride towards Astorga, the principal town of the region. In Astorga you can visit the gothic cathedral and see the Bishop's Palace built by Gaudi. ~ 32 miles

Day 4 Astorga to Villafranca.
A bus transfer helps you on your way as you continue west on the Pilgrims' Route. The countryside is hilly and you are rewarded with sweeping views over the Castilian Hills. ~ 31 miles (+16 miles by bus)

Day 5 Villafranca to Sarria.
The route today takes you into the green province of Galicia where you will notice the distinctive old farm buildings reminiscent of celtic times. ~ 29 miles

Day 6 Sarria to Lugo.
An easy day takes you through pretty villages and a sheep farming area to reach the medieval and completely walled town of Lugo. ~ 20 miles

Day 7 Lugo to Santiago de Compostela.
Pleasant cycling through a green landscape brings you to picturesque Lake Sobrado, a lovely spot for a picnic. An optional bus transfer can be taken as you approach your destination of Santiago de Compostela. On arrival, there is, of course, much to see. ~ 39 miles (+22 miles by bus)

Day 8 Departure.
